Mercurial > pidgin
comparison libpurple/protocols/jabber/iq.c @ 23759:315151da0dc6
Basic Google Talk voice call support. No UI; receiving a call auto-accepts it.
author | Sean Egan <seanegan@gmail.com> |
---|---|
date | Wed, 05 Sep 2007 00:47:58 +0000 |
parents | c58b83d2b188 |
children | 60f5abc6cf0c |
comparison
equal
deleted
inserted
replaced
23758:1e5d5d55a231 | 23759:315151da0dc6 |
---|---|
330 if(type && query && (xmlns = xmlnode_get_namespace(query))) { | 330 if(type && query && (xmlns = xmlnode_get_namespace(query))) { |
331 if((jih = g_hash_table_lookup(iq_handlers, xmlns))) { | 331 if((jih = g_hash_table_lookup(iq_handlers, xmlns))) { |
332 jih(js, packet); | 332 jih(js, packet); |
333 return; | 333 return; |
334 } | 334 } |
335 } | |
336 | |
337 if (xmlnode_get_child_with_namespace(packet, "session", "http://www.google.com/session")) { | |
338 jabber_google_session_parse(js, packet); | |
339 return; | |
335 } | 340 } |
336 | 341 |
337 if(xmlnode_get_child_with_namespace(packet, "si", "http://jabber.org/protocol/si")) { | 342 if(xmlnode_get_child_with_namespace(packet, "si", "http://jabber.org/protocol/si")) { |
338 jabber_si_parse(js, packet); | 343 jabber_si_parse(js, packet); |
339 return; | 344 return; |